1, the definition of decimal point:
The decimal point is a mathematical symbol written as ".",which is used to separate the integer part from the decimal part in decimal system.
2. Definition of decimals:
Decimals consist of integer parts, decimal points and decimal parts. Decimals whose integer part is 0 are pure decimals; Decimals whose integer part is not 0 are called decimals.
3, the characteristics of the decimal point:
The decimal point is a demarcation point, with an integer part on the left and a decimal part on the right. The decimal point can be used to indicate the boundary between the integer part and the decimal part. For example, the ".5" in 1.5 is the decimal point, indicating the boundary between the integer part and the decimal part. At the same time, decimal points can also be used to indicate the accuracy of numbers. For example, in scientific calculation, the number of digits after the decimal point can indicate the accuracy of calculation.
